Well I'm back from Westfield/Samsung Pop-Up store and what can I say - the blue looks pretty damn horrendous.

Shot taken with the S3 fyi:

d2fb1c84.jpg


Shot's taken with SGSII:

20120523_164614.jpg


20120523_170030.jpg

A few things that bugged me

- no brightness adjust when swiping status bar
- because the phone is blue and not black you can see a tiny black border around the screen - you can notice it in the pic above - very annoying to me.
- The white model looks better - and I dislike white phones in general
- Same cheap feel to the home button; like on S2
- Blue is DAMN FUGLY.
- I wished they made the screen brighter - it's about the same as the S2.

Things I liked:

- Smooth and fast
- Felt nice-ish in the hand
- Can change font size of UI
- Pentile Matrix not an issue


So. I'm not rushing out to get one - unless it's a really, really good deal.
